Modern truck servicing requires technicians to understand complex electronic systems in addition to traditional mechanical components. Engine management, transmission controls, emissions systems, electronic braking, and communication networks can all generate diagnostic challenges. Truck diagnostic software provides a way to communicate with supported electronic systems and collect useful information about their operation. Truck diagnostic tools provide the physical connection required for this process. When these resources are combined with high quality PDF service manuals, workshops can create a more complete diagnostic environment that supports systematic troubleshooting and technical repair work.
One of the main advantages of truck diagnostic software is its ability to provide electronic information that may not be visible through a conventional inspection. Depending on the supported application, technicians can retrieve fault codes, examine live parameters, inspect control modules, and perform selected diagnostic functions. This information can help identify where further testing should begin. However, diagnostic software should not be considered a replacement for professional testing. A fault code may identify a circuit or system without confirming the exact failed component. Technicians can use the available information together with service procedures to investigate possible causes before making a repair decision.
Truck diagnostic tools connect the diagnostic computer to the vehicle and allow communication with supported electronic modules. Different truck models can require different interface types, communication protocols, and software configurations. Therefore, compatibility should always be confirmed before purchasing or using diagnostic equipment. A stable communication connection is important during diagnostic procedures because interrupted communication can make testing more difficult. Workshops should regularly inspect interface cables, connectors, and other hardware. Proper maintenance of diagnostic equipment can support consistent performance and help reduce unnecessary interruptions during vehicle servicing.
A diagnostic laptop for trucks provides a convenient working platform for commercial vehicle diagnostics. Technicians can install diagnostic applications, store high quality PDF service manuals, and access wiring diagrams from one computer. A heavy duty diagnostic laptop can be particularly useful for workshops that handle multiple commercial vehicle brands. The computer should meet the technical requirements of the intended applications, including operating system compatibility, processing performance, memory, storage, and connection options. Heavy duty diagnostic software can expand the capabilities of a workshop by supporting suitable commercial vehicle systems. Engine faults are only one category of potential problems. Technicians may also need to investigate transmission controls, emissions systems, braking modules, body controllers, and communication networks. The ability to collect information from different systems can help technicians understand whether a problem is isolated or connected to another fault. OEM diagnostic software and dealer diagnostic software can provide additional manufacturer-specific functionality where appropriate. Selecting software according to the vehicles actually serviced can make the diagnostic setup more useful.
High quality PDF service manuals remain important even when a workshop has advanced diagnostic equipment. Electronic systems can report abnormal conditions, but technicians often need technical procedures to determine why those conditions exist. Manuals can provide wiring diagrams, component locations, electrical specifications, adjustment information, and repair instructions. Digital documentation can be searched quickly and stored on the same diagnostic laptop used for truck diagnostics. This creates a convenient connection between electronic information and technical references, helping technicians move from fault identification to physical testing.
